One of Hungary’s most successful grape varieties, it began its career as a table grape, but soon proved to be an excellent wine grape as well.
This early ripening variety is the first of our new wines to be fermented and fans will be able to enjoy it at the end of August. Its main attraction is its distinctive aroma and flavour, while its fans also like its lower alcohol, round acidity and light body. In summer it is excellent chilled, even in a spritzer.
